Michigan HB4890 amends the definition of "collection agency" in 1989 PA 211, clarifying which entities are included and excluded from this definition. The bill specifies that a collection agency includes individuals representing themselves as such in collection or repossession activities, and those acting under a court order. It excludes certain entities from the definition, such as regular employees collecting for one employer in the employer's name, and financial institutions collecting their own claims.
